Presidio
Ecology Trail
San Francisco, 94129, United States
Leading down from Inspiration Point in the Presidio National Park is the 1.4-mile Ecology Trail. Used as a refugee camp after the 1906 earthquake, the surrounding landscape features a redwood grove, serpentine grasslands, and from May until August, the small pink blooms of the endangered Presidio clarkia flower. Occasional glimpses of the San Francisco Bay and the Palace of Fine Arts are visible through the trees. Also, a spur trail connects to a picnic area at El Polin Springs, where fresh water bubbles from a rock wall. Free activity guides are available for children at the park’s visitor center.
Insider Tip:
Inspiration Point offers free parking that puts you right at the top of the trail.
